Gaiam BalanceBall Chair as a Treatment for Chronic Back Pain: How It Came To Be and What It’s About
This chair was developed by Gaiam, a company that specializes in organic, yoga and fitness products, and Dr. Randy Weinzoff, a 1990 graduate of Palmer College Chiropractic and chiropractic pioneer. They say Dr. Weinzoff has been providing a full spectrum approach to health and well-being for over 14 years. He’s a member of the National Strength and Conditioning Association, and specializes in exercise and sports rehabilitation, alleviation of chronic pain and nutritional analysis.
The Gaiam BalanceBall Chair is a revolution in alternative seating at home and in the office, and apparently continues to be a customer favorite. It’s patented design combines fitness with comfort and ergonomic back support at an affordable price. Gaiam developed this chair with Dr. Weinzoff as an effective tool for strengthening core muscles and improving spinal alignment. The removable BalanceBall can be used for exercises on or off the chair, which is a handy aspect.

BalanceBall Chair Features, Details and What Comes With It:
- It’s designed for people 5’-5’11″ weighing up to 300 lbs.
- It has rolling, lockable castor wheels and an adjustable support bar
- It comes with an air pump and desktop workout guide for an effective low-impact workout and stretching routine
- It uses a removable professional grade 20.5” anti-burst exercise ball (vinyl-no latex)
- It’s stable but lightweight (13 lbs), and the base is made from molded PVC
- Easy 1-tool assembly

Barbara Brady from Woman’s Day had picked it up, and gave her opinion:
The Pros: “…more comfortable than I expected, and it made me more conscious about sitting up straight and engaging my core muscles. As office furniture/exercise equipment goes, it’s also… reasonable… It makes a great conversation starter, too—everyone who enters my office since it’s arrival wants to try it.”
The Cons: “Thanks to the chair base and back, it’s still possible to get lazy and slump forward or back if you have the urge… I found the ball a little too low considering the length of my legs and the height of my very ergonomically-incorrect desk. So my stomach and back might get stronger, but I could end up with carpal tunnel. Hmmm…”
What this tells you is that you need to consider your desk height, the chair height, etc., which you should always do with furniture and seating to avoid back injury.
